About 1,3-dimethylimidazol-1-ium;ethane

1,3-dimethylimidazol-1-ium;ethane (PubChem CID 90798185) has the molecular formula C7H15N2+ and a molecular weight of 127.21 g/mol. Its IUPAC name is 1,3-dimethylimidazol-1-ium;ethane.
